Seems even the sparrows love this place 🐦❤️ Although cinnamon rolls originally come from Scandinavia, Germany has truly made them its own — here they’re called “Zimtschnecke” (literally “cinnamon snail”) 🐌✨ And unlike the super buttery and sugary Danish versions, these are less sweet and not overly rich… so delicious!
